Councilman resigns brand new seat

Jan 21, 2026 at 07:00 am by Dale-RB


Recently-elected Plymouth Town Councilman Steven Brown abruptly resigned his post at last week’s Council meeting, offering no specific reason for surrendering the seat he won in the municipal election two months earlier.

In making his announcement at the start of Council’s January 12 session, Brown cited unspecified “personal reasons” for his immediate resignation before walking from the room. Contacted later by phone, Brown declined to comment about his decision.

Brown’s announcement came less than five minutes into the meeting when he picked up his microphone following a visible glance and a nod from Mayor Crystal Davis. As he began speaking, Davis and Mayor Pro Temp Donsenia Teel exchanged whispers. As Brown walked from the council table, Davis added “thank you, Mr. Brown...”
